Carbon dioxide (CO₂) has been successfully used as a fire extinguishing agent for over a century and remains one of the most effective gaseous suppression agents for protecting enclosed, normally unoccupied, or intermittently occupied hazards. Because CO₂ extinguishes fire without leaving residue or damaging sensitive equipment, it is particularly suitable for facilities where business continuity and equipment protection are critical.

Safety Considerations
Because carbon dioxide extinguishes fire by reducing oxygen concentration, Southpole Firetec designs these systems primarily for normally unoccupied or intermittently occupied areas. Every installation incorporates comprehensive safety measures, including pre-discharge alarms, programmable time delays, emergency abort stations, warning signage, and emergency evacuation procedures to safeguard personnel.
